Abstract :
The need for electrical energy in Indonesia is increasing every year. With this situation,
it will cause scarcity and limitations on electrical energy. Therefore, the use of renewable
energy needs to be increased. One of the renewable energy whose development is quite
rapid is the Solar Power Plant which is a generating sistem derived from solar photon
energy which is converted into electrical energy. Solar panels used in solar power plants
must be monitored so that their performance can be analyzed. Therefore, in this study, a
tool was made to monitor solar power plants in the form of a data logger. The components
used are ESP32, PZEM-003, and DS18B20 temperature sensor. The ESP32 functions as
a microcontroller, PZEM-003 functions as a sensor that measures voltage and current,
and the DS18B20 temperature sensor functions as a temperature sensor. This study will
compare the accuracy level of the data logger with conventional measuring instruments.
To measure voltage and current using a multimeter SANWA DMM RD701 and for
temperature using Thermo Gun type HG01. After conducting a comparison of the
obtained data is calculated using the relative error formula. For voltage relatif faults of
0.16%, for currents of 4% and for temperatures of 0.61%. From the data that has been
obtained, the data logger can be said to be accurate.
